We work off of the git.kernel.org trees, not github :) > Some older families of USB2 cameras (STC-XXXXXUSB) do not support querying > only the first 8 bytes of their > device descriptor and therefore fail at enumeration on USB3 HCDs, with babble > error -75 as they send more than > the expected 8 bytes. The proposed patch extends the mechanism used for non > USB3 HCDs in the first part of > the same function, and successively tries to query both the 8 byte prefix of > the device descriptor, as well as > the whole device descriptor (in case the old style query of the 8 byte prefix > fails). > In fact, for the cameras I try to fix, the preferred condition is the > negation of the one in the proposed patch, > "if (!USE_NEW_SCHEME(retry_counter))", to try first the version successful on > this case, but I keep the > current order of the "if" branches to ensure clean continuation of support > for other supported devices. > > Signed-off-by: Marius C Silaghi <msila...@fit.edu> I'll let Sarah take this patch, if it passes her testing. thanks, greg k-h -- To unsubscribe from this list: send the line "unsubscribe linux-kernel" in the body of a message to majord...@vger.kernel.org More majordomo info at http://vger.kernel.org/majordomo-info.html Please read the FAQ at http://www.tux.org/lkml/
